ANNOUNCEMENT – MINIMUM PRICE GUIDANCE OF €9.00 PER NEW SHARE

The enclosed information constitutes inside information as defined in Regulation (EU) No 596/2014 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 16 April 2014 on market abuse and regulated information as defined in the Royal Decree of 14 November 2007 regarding the duties of issuers of financial instruments, which have been admitted for trading on a regulated market.

Cenergy Holdings S.A. announces today that, in view of the strong demand expressed so far in the context of the book building for the Institutional Offer, and further to its announcement on 8 October 2024 in connection with publication of its Prospectus, it is informing investors participating in the Institutional Offer that bids below the amount of nine euros (€9.00) per New Share will most likely not be considered for allocation of New Shares in the Institutional Offer.

As announced on 8 October 2024 and further described in the Prospectus, the Offer Price in the Belgian Public Offer, the Greek Public Offer and the Institutional Offer will be identical. The Offer Price is expected to be determined by the Company on the basis of a bookbuilding process for the Institutional Offer, taking into account various relevant qualitative and quantitative elements, including but not limited to the number of New Shares for which subscription applications are received, the size of subscription applications received, the quality of the investors submitting such subscription applications and the prices at which the subscription applications were made, as well as market conditions at that time.

Capitalised terms used but not defined herein shall have the meaning ascribed to such terms in the Prospectus.

The Offer period began on 8 October 2024 at 9.00 a.m. Central European Time (CET) (10.00 a.m. Greek time) and is expected to end at 15.00 CET (16.00 Greek time) on 10 October 2024 (the "Offer Period"), subject to extension of the timetable for the Offer.

The Belgian Financial Services and Markets Authority (the "FSMA") approved the Prospectus in accordance with Article 20 of the Prospectus Regulation on 7 October 2024. The FSMA only approved the Prospectus (including the summary of the Prospectus) as meeting the standards of completeness, comprehensibility and consistency imposed by the Prospectus Regulation. Such approval should not be considered as an endorsement of the New Shares that are the subject of the Prospectus. Investors should make their own assessment as to the suitability of investing in the New Shares. The Prospectus has, following its approval by the FSMA, been notified to the Hellenic Capital Market Commission (the "HCMC") for passporting in accordance with Articles 24 and 25 of the Prospectus Regulation.
